ERR is average views per post over the last 30 days divided by subscribers, the definition TGStat uses, so this figure is comparable with the one you will see elsewhere. It falls structurally as a channel grows: a high ERR on a small channel and a low one on a large channel describe reach mathematics, not quality. We publish the figure and the sample it came from and pass no verdict on it.
ER is defined industry-wide as (forwards + reactions + comments) ÷ views— note the denominator is views, not subscribers. Telegram’s public web preview carries views and reactions but not forward or comment counts, so the reaction rate above is the reactions term only and is therefore a floor: the true ER for this channel is higher by an amount we have not measured and will not estimate.

An ad marker, not a judgement about a post. A post is counted here because it carries one of two explicit markings: an erid token, which Russian law has required on paid placements since 2022 and which is issued against a specific advertising contract, or a #реклама / #ad hashtag in the body, which is the channel declaring it itself. The first is documentary; the second is a self-declaration and is weaker. No classifier reads the text and decides — nothing on this site guesses that a post is an advertisement.
This is a floor, and it can only ever be a floor.A channel that runs paid placements without marking them produces no marker for us to count, and an unmarked ad is indistinguishable from an ordinary post on the public surface. The ad load above therefore means “the share of posts that declared themselves”, never “the share of posts that were paid for”. A low figure is not evidence of a channel that runs few ads.
